Sand Castle Sculpture Competition

Saturday July 12, 2008 11:30 am to 4 pm

 

Every year Milford hosts it's annual Sand Castle Contest at Walnut Beach in Milford, CT.  Walnut Beach is located in a section of Milford called, Devon.

Participants and spectators gather around just after high tide to enjoy this spectacular event.  Anyone can participate.  You must pre-register to be entered as an individual or as a team by age group.  Simple rules to this contest.  The main goal is to just have fun.  Only beach materials may be used to create your masterpiece in the sand.  Once the contest is over spectators and participants slowly watch the high tide reclaim the beach and their sculptures.
